Dan Dicko Dankoulodo University of Maradi in Niger, launches its digitalization process

At the start of the 2022 academic year, the Dan Dicko Dankoulodo University of Maradi (UDDM) began digitalizing its student registration and tuition fee collection processes, as part of the “Digital Financial Services for Resilience” (DFS4Res) programme implemented by UNCDF. This digitalization has enabled the university to collect more than 100 million FCFA in additional revenue. The universities of Niamey (UAM) and Agadez (UAZ) are following suit. Ultimately, the government of Niger aims to digitalize all the country's public universities, for more efficient and transparent management of administrative and academic activities.

This case study outlines the steps and lessons learned from this digitalization of payments. It is a useful case study for stakeholders in West Africa considering a similar digital transformation. The study serves as a user guide, describing the critical considerations and the seven essential steps of such a digital transition, and provides valuable resources for institutions seeking to strengthen their digital capabilities and optimize their financial outcomes.
